Six Grapes 'Vila Velha'

The Six Grapes ‘Special Vila Velha Edition’ is a limited bottling drawn exclusively from the finest grapes grown at Quinta da Vila Velha – one of the four Douro estates that supplies Graham’s Port. The property was purchased by the late third-generation port producer, James Symington, in 1987. For over three decades, James restored and extended the quinta into a well-tended 145-hectare riverside property with 55 hectares under vine. With its privileged position on the south bank of the Douro River, Vila Velha produces well-structured and balanced wines that form key components of Graham’s Vintage Ports.

Reviews

James Suckling
4/19/2023
Points:
94

Deep dark-fruited character with crushed oranges, flowers and wet stone character. Full and rich but crunchy with fresh juiciness to it. Wide and compact tannins, yet fine and textured and very long. Firm and structured. Sweet and fruit-forward. A special edition ruby, made with old vines. It’s a crusted port! Mostly 2020 and 2019. Unfined and not filtered. Drink or hold.

Wine Spectator
8/31/2023
Points:
91

Packs a pretty good core altogether, with bramble-laced açaí berry, boysenberry and dark plum fruit notes working nicely with anise and fruitcake flavors. The finish shows sneaky length and is underscored by a subtle tug of earth. Yummy stuff. Drink now through 2025. 1,000 cases made, 600 cases imported.

- James Molesworth
